The Department of Commerce, NOAA, is soliciting five fiberglass tide house enclosures to support oceanographic data collection operations under solicitation number 1305M226Q0141, issued on June 9, 2026, with responses due by June 16, 2026, at 12:00 EDT. This procurement is structured as a total small business set-aside under FAR 19.5, exclusively open to small businesses including HUBZone, SDVOSB, WOSB, EDWOSB, and 8(a) concerns, with NAICS code 326199. The enclosures, to be delivered FOB Destination to 7600 Sand Point Way NE, Seattle, WA 98115 no later than August 1, 2026, include four standard units measuring 72" wide by 48" deep and one larger unit measuring 72" wide by 72" deep, all with a maximum height of 92". Each enclosure must be insulated with walls no thicker than 3 inches, internally reinforced for structural integrity, and designed for lifting by both forklift and crane. Internal specifications require vertical and horizontal struts reaching a minimum height of 74 inches, two Unistrut runs per side wall and four on the back wall each capable of supporting 120 lbs indefinitely, and a vertically adjustable 18-inch deep shelf spanning the back wall with mounting hardware. The enclosures must withstand sustained winds of 80 mph and occasional gusts up to 150 mph. The solicitation operates under a low priced, technically acceptable (LPTA) evaluation model, where offers must pass two mandatory gates: technical acceptability verified by submitted equipment specification sheets, and price competitiveness. Offers must be submitted via email to kyle.lawrence@noaa.gov in PDF or Microsoft Word format, accompanied by signed SF 1449 and any applicable SF 30 forms. All offerors must maintain an active SAM registration and provide their Unique Entity ID and CAGE Code, with quotes valid for at least 60 days. The procurement incorporates multiple FAR and Commerce Acquisition Regulation clauses, including sustainable products and services, Buy American, accelerated payments to small business subcontractors, electronic funds transfer, and security prohibitions, each subject to JAN 2026 deviations where indicated.
